Introduction to Seawall Building
Seawalls play an essential job in coastal defense. They act as a barrier in between land and water, preserving Houses from erosion, flooding, plus the harmful forces of waves and storms. No matter whether you live close to the ocean, a lake, or maybe a river, aquiring a solid and very well-taken care of seawall can stop costly damages and safeguard your financial investment.

Exactly what is a Seawall?
A seawall can be a construction crafted alongside the shoreline to circumvent erosion and safeguard the land behind it. They are usually made from resources like concrete, steel, vinyl, or wood, as well as their style relies on aspects including the nearby natural environment, wave intensity, and the type of soil. Seawalls are Utilized in both residential and business properties, from defending Beach front homes to safeguarding infrastructure like streets, bridges, and ports.

The necessity of Seawall Construction
Seawall building is an important Element of guarding coastal regions. Without correct seawall installation, land can erode after some time due to the continual pounding of waves. This erosion may result in assets damage, loss of land, as well as pose a threat to residences and enterprises. Seawalls don't just prevent erosion but additionally aid decrease the affect of storm surges and flooding, building them important in spots liable to hurricanes or heavy storms.

Types of Seawalls
When thinking about seawall development, it’s important to understand the differing types of seawalls obtainable. The most common forms contain:

Vertical Seawalls: They are the commonest kind of seawall, crafted to absorb the immediate effect of waves. Vertical seawalls are perfect for places with superior wave action but should be sturdy plenty of to withstand major stress.

Curved Seawalls: Curved or stepped seawalls are built to reflect wave Strength again to the sea, lessening the effect of waves over the structure by itself. These are generally used in places with fewer extreme wave action.

Mound Seawalls: Crafted from piles of all-natural resources like rocks or boulders, mound seawalls tend to be more all-natural-hunting and infrequently Employed in locations the place erosion is a priority but wave motion is average.

Composite Seawalls: A combination of components like steel, concrete, and vinyl, composite seawalls are applied for his or her longevity and flexibility in numerous environments.

Every single style of seawall has its own Advantages and downsides, dependant upon your site and the precise requires of your property. Consulting an expert seawall contractor will allow you to establish the best choice in your situation.

Seawall Development Course of action
The whole process of creating a seawall consists of quite a few steps, Every essential to ensuring The steadiness and performance with the framework. Listed here’s a breakdown of the typical seawall construction system:

Site Evaluation: Before design starts, the realm is surveyed to assess the ailment with the shoreline, soil variety, and possible environmental impacts. This phase will help in analyzing the top sort of seawall and also the materials wanted.

Design and style and Engineering: Once the web page has become assessed, engineers will style the seawall dependant on the particular specifications of The situation. The design incorporates the height, thickness, and elements to ensure the seawall can face up to the nearby wave and climatic conditions.

Permitting: Seawall building often calls for permits from local or federal businesses, particularly when it impacts wetlands or other sensitive parts. An expert seawall contractor will cope with the permitting approach to ensure compliance with all rules.

Design: After the permits are acquired, the development process starts. This consists of digging a trench for the foundation, installing the seawall resources, and securing them set up. According to the dimensions and complexity of the seawall, this process might take various months.

Finishing and Inspection: Once the seawall is developed, It will probably be inspected to make sure it fulfills all basic safety and environmental criteria. The ultimate move involves landscaping and restoring the realm throughout the seawall to blend Together with the pure environment.

Seawall Maintenance: Maintaining Your Expense
Seawalls, Like all construction, are topic to dress in and tear after a while. Cracks, holes, and structural hurt can come about resulting from frequent publicity to drinking water, climate, and environmental adjustments. Typical seawall fix and upkeep are essential to make sure the composition stays sturdy and practical.

Typical Seawall Problems
Below are a few of the commonest troubles which could arise with seawalls:

Cracking: Cracks can surface as a consequence of settling, weather conditions cheap adjustments, or improper set up. Modest cracks may not feel major, However they can lead to extra comprehensive harm if remaining unchecked.

Erosion Driving the Seawall: As time passes, h2o could seep through cracks or gaps from the seawall, leading to erosion at the rear of the framework. This can lead to instability and eventual failure with the seawall.

Sinkholes: Sinkholes might acquire In the event the soil at the rear of the seawall is washed away, building voids that compromise the wall’s structural integrity.

Corrosion: Steel seawalls are specially prone to corrosion as a consequence of continual publicity to saltwater. As time passes, This tends to weaken the seawall and result in failure.

Leaning or Bowing: A seawall may possibly start to lean or bow if it wasn’t installed accurately or if it’s less than a lot of force from the drinking water. This is an indication that speedy restore is required.

Seawall Repair service Techniques
Seawall fix approaches depend on the extent from the hurt and the sort of seawall. Below are a few common strategies utilized by contractors to repair service seawalls:

Crack Sealing: For insignificant cracks, contractors may use sealants or epoxy injections to fill the cracks and prevent additional injury.

Soil Stabilization: If your soil guiding the seawall is eroding, contractors may perhaps utilize a process known as soil grouting to stabilize the area. This requires injecting grout to the soil to fill voids and reinforce the inspiration.

Tieback Installation: If a seawall is leaning or bowing, tiebacks might be set up to anchor the wall and provide additional assistance.

Seawall Cap Replacement: The seawall cap will be the topmost portion of the seawall and could become weakened eventually. Changing the cap will help to avoid drinking water from seeping in to the wall and causing further destruction.

Entire Alternative: In situations in which the seawall is severely weakened, a whole substitute might be necessary. Though costlier, replacing the seawall makes sure prolonged-phrase security in your house.
